After years of responding to Eau Galle properties, a handful of causes show up again and again. Here's what to watch for.
Aging plumbing, sudden temperature swings, and worn supply lines are among the most common reasons Eau Galle residents call us. A single burst pipe can release hundreds of gallons before it's noticed, especially overnight.
Storm damage often shows up first as a small ceiling stain in Eau Galle properties, but by the time it's visible, water has usually already reached the insulation and framing underneath.
A failed sump pump during a heavy rain event is one of the fastest ways a Eau Galle basement goes from dry to flooded — often within a single storm, with little warning.
Water heaters, washing machines, dishwashers, and HVAC condensation lines are common — and often overlooked — sources of slow leaks that eventually cause significant damage in Eau Galle properties if left unnoticed.
Improper grading around a Eau Galle property's foundation can direct rainwater toward the structure instead of away from it, leading to chronic basement or crawlspace moisture over time.
After a fire is out, the water used to fight it often causes its own separate restoration need across affected Eau Galle floors and rooms, sometimes worse than the fire itself.

Plenty of Eau Galle homeowners try to handle a small water event themselves before calling us. Here's what usually gets missed.
The visible water on your Eau Galle flo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all, travels along subfloor seams, and pools inside wall cavities where a rented fan will never reach it. Without professional-grade dehumidification and moisture monitoring, that h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face looks and feels dry to the touch.
There's also the insurance side to consider. Without professional documentation — moisture readings, photos, a written scope of work — it can be much harder to support a claim if secondary damage shows up later. Our Eau Galle technicians build that documentation as part of every job, protecting you if issues surface down the road.
None of this means every spill needs a professional crew — a small, contained, surface-level spill that's dried within a few hours is usually fine to handle yourself. But once water has soaked into flooring, baseboards, or drywall, or if it's been sitting for more than a few hours, it's worth a call to make sure nothing's hiding beneath the surface.
Every water loss is different, but these general safety steps apply to most Eau Galle calls we receive.
If the water is coming from a pipe, appliance, or fixture you can safely reach, shut off the supply valve or main.
Never touch electrical switches, outlets, or appliances that are wet or near standing water — the risk of shock is real.
If it's safe, move furniture, electronics, and important documents away from the affected area or up off the floor.
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ved — this helps your insurance claim later.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Eau Galle team arrives with drying equipment.
Delaying the call is the most common mistake we see. Standing water only gets more expensive to fix the longer it sits.
